Take Point Poker Casino, for instance. Their welcome package advertises 50 free spins on a popular slot. The spins land on a reel that looks like a neon carnival, but the wagering requirements are set at 40x the bonus amount. That translates to a need to gamble $2,000 before you can even think about withdrawing a single cent of winnings. It’s a trap disguised as a treat.
- Free spins are locked behind a 30‑40× wagering clause.
- Bonus cash often expires within 7 days.
- Withdrawal limits cap you at a few hundred dollars, regardless of how much you win.
And then there’s the dreaded “maximum cashout” rule that slashes any hope of a life‑changing win. It’s a polite way of saying, “Enjoy the illusion, but we won’t let you keep much of it.”

It’s not all doom and gloom, though. If you treat the free spins as a trial run – a low‑stakes way to test a platform’s reliability, game selection, and support responsiveness – you can extract some value. Use them to gauge whether the casino’s payment methods align with your preferences, or whether their live chat actually answers questions without resorting to generic scripts. That’s the only sensible way to approach a “free” offer without getting burned.
